纯电动汽车经济性换挡规律驱动力波动控制研究
Tractive Effort Fluctuation Control Study on the Shift Schedule of Fuel Economy of Pure Electric Vehicle

Abstract
Driving force fluctuates as a pure electric vehicle shifts with the shift schedule of fuel econo-my.For this reason,the tractive effort fluctuation control strategy was proposed.There was a correla-tion between the driving motor current and the output torque of the motor.A model of motor output torque estimation based on radial basis neural network was designed.According to the torque estima-tion,the driving force was calculated.Compensation torque required by driving motor to eliminate driv-ing force fluctuation was analyzed.The dynamic simulation system of pure electric vehicle was estab-lished by AMESim software to verify the accuracy of torque estimation,and experimental results used control strategy was compared with unused.The experimental results show that the error rate of torque estimation is less than 0.09.The curve of vehicle speed data change is smooth before and after the shift, and the power and driving comfort of the vehicle is improved.关键词
